It's hard to turn regular season success into postseason wins, a fact Madison Country Day can now relate to. They came up short against the St. Ambrose Academy Guardians on Saturday, falling 3-0.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est defeat Madison Country Day has suffered since October 2nd.
Ruby Jones paced Madison Country Day's offense, picking up six kills. Jones got some help from Ashlyn Frazer and her 20 assists.
Madison Country Day's loss dropped their record down to 10-10. As for St. Ambrose Academy, they have been performing well recently as they've won nine of their last 11 cont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 21-12 record this season.
Madison Country Day does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for St. Ambrose Academy, they will take on Barneveld at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day.
